Personal Support Workers play a pivotal role in our health care system. At Spectrum Health Care, they work closely with our patients and their families, providing personal care and support with activities of daily living. The care provided by Personal Support Workers ensures patients can recover safely from an acute illness or remain in their homes throughout the aging process.

  • Providing personal care, hygiene, and assistance with activities of daily living (bathing, toileting, skincare, light meal preparation, feeding, etc)

Qualifications
  • Have one of the following qualifications (required):
    • Valid Personal Support Worker Certificate from a Ministry of Training, Colleges, and Universities or the Ministry of Education approved program.
    • RN/RPN Student who with a minimum successful completion of year one of the program.
    • Internationally licensed Nurse, Midwife, or Physician.
  • Physical ability to meet the demands of the job (ex: the ability to stand, bend, walk, crouch, kneel and reach freely for extended periods, ability to lift 23 kg independently, ability to assist clients with standing, walking, sitting; able to reposition clients in bed)
  • Demonstrated ability to provide exceptional personal care and customer service
  • Valid Standard First Aid and Level C CPR
  • Valid Vulnerable Sector Criminal Check
  • Updated immunization record including TB Test (last 12 months)
  • Proficient verbal and written English communication skills (Additional language skills considered an asset)
